서브시전, 이름만 들어도 뭔가 전문적인 느낌이 들지 않나요? 마치 복잡한 수수께끼처럼 느껴지기도 합니다. 하지만 걱정 마세요! 오늘은 이 서브시전의 세계를 쉽고 재미있게 탐험해 보려고 합니다. 특히, 많은 분들이 궁금해하시는 부분, 바로 서브시전의 가격에 대해 속 시원하게 파헤쳐 볼 거예요. 복잡한 용어는 최대한 풀어서 설명하고, 여러분의 궁금증을 시원하게 해결해 드리겠습니다. 지금부터 서브시전의 매력에 푹 빠져보세요!
🔍 핵심 요약
✅ 서브시전은 특정 가격 없이, 다양한 형태와 조건으로 제공될 수 있습니다.
✅ 오픈소스 프로젝트 또는 커뮤니티 기반으로, 누구나 접근하고 활용할 수 있는 경우가 많습니다.
✅ 사용 목적, 범위, 그리고 지원 여부에 따라 비용이 발생할 수 있습니다.
✅ 라이선스 조건에 따라 자유로운 사용, 수정, 배포가 가능하며, 저작권 관련 사항을 확인해야 합니다.
✅ 서브시전의 가치는 금전적인 부분을 넘어, 기술적 성장과 커뮤니티 기여 등 다양한 형태로 나타납니다.
서브시전, 정확히 뭐하는 녀석일까?
서브시전은 단순히 기술적인 용어 그 이상입니다. 쉽게 말해, 소프트웨어 개발 프로젝트의 역사를 기록하고 관리하는 시스템이라고 할 수 있습니다. 마치 타임머신처럼, 과거의 코드 상태로 돌아가거나 변경 사항을 추적할 수 있게 해주죠. 이 강력한 기능 덕분에, 여러 사람이 함께 개발하는 프로젝트에서 협업 효율을 극대화하고, 오류 발생 시 신속하게 대처할 수 있습니다. 서브시전의 핵심 기능은 버전 관리, 변경 사항 추적, 그리고 협업 지원입니다.
서브시전의 핵심 기능: 버전 관리와 협업
서브시전은 개발자가 코드를 수정하고, 그 변경 사항을 기록하고 관리하는 데 필수적인 도구입니다. 각 버전의 코드를 저장하고, 필요에 따라 이전 버전으로 되돌아갈 수 있게 해줍니다. 마치 요리 레시피처럼, 문제가 발생했을 때 이전 단계로 돌아가서 수정할 수 있는 것이죠. 또한, 여러 개발자가 동시에 작업하는 환경에서 코드 충돌을 방지하고, 효율적인 협업을 가능하게 합니다.
서브시전의 중요성: 프로젝트 관리의 혁신
과거에는 수많은 개발자들이 각자의 컴퓨터에서 코드를 수정하고, 수동으로 파일을 주고받으며 작업을 했습니다. 당연히, 버전 관리도 제대로 되지 않아, 어떤 코드가 최신인지, 어떤 변경 사항이 적용되었는지 혼란이 많았습니다. 서브시전은 이러한 문제를 해결해 주었습니다. 덕분에, 대규모 프로젝트에서도 체계적인 코드 관리가 가능해졌고, 개발 효율성이 획기적으로 향상되었습니다. 이제 서브시전은 단순한 도구를 넘어, 현대적인 소프트웨어 개발의 필수 요소가 되었습니다.
| 기능 | 설명 |
|---|---|
| 버전 관리 | 코드의 변경 사항을 기록하고, 이전 버전으로 복원할 수 있게 해줍니다. |
| 변경 사항 추적 | 누가, 언제, 무엇을 변경했는지 쉽게 확인할 수 있습니다. |
| 협업 지원 | 여러 개발자가 동시에 작업할 때 코드 충돌을 방지하고, 효율적인 협업을 가능하게 합니다. |
서브시전의 가격, 정말 0원일까?
"서브시전 가격"이라는 키워드로 검색하다 보면, 정말 0원인지 궁금해지기 마련입니다. 결론부터 말하자면, 서브시전 자체는 특정 가격이 정해져 있지 않습니다. 오픈소스 프로젝트로 제공되기 때문에, 누구나 자유롭게 사용하고, 수정하고, 배포할 수 있습니다. 하지만, 서브시전을 사용하는 환경, 즉, 서버 환경 구축이나 특정 기능을 사용하기 위한 추가적인 도구, 또는 교육 등에 따라 비용이 발생할 수 있습니다.
서브시전 무료 사용의 비밀: 오픈소스 라이선스
서브시전이 0원으로 사용 가능한 이유는 바로 오픈소스 라이선스 때문입니다. 오픈소스는 누구나 자유롭게 소스 코드를 열람하고, 수정하고, 배포할 수 있도록 허용하는 라이선스입니다. 서브시전은 이러한 오픈소스 라이선스를 따르기 때문에, 별도의 사용료 없이 사용할 수 있습니다. 다만, 사용자는 라이선스 조건을 준수해야 하며, 라이선스에 명시된 의무를 다해야 합니다.
숨겨진 비용: 서버 환경과 유지 보수
서브시전을 사용하기 위해서는 서버 환경을 구축해야 합니다. 개인적인 프로젝트라면, 로컬 환경에서 사용할 수도 있지만, 팀 프로젝트나 여러 사람이 함께 작업하는 경우에는 서버가 필수적입니다. 서버 구축에는 하드웨어, 네트워크, 그리고 서버 관리 인력에 대한 비용이 발생할 수 있습니다. 또한, 서버를 유지하고 관리하는 데에도 지속적인 비용이 발생할 수 있습니다.
| 비용 요소 | 설명 |
|---|---|
| 서버 하드웨어 | 서브시전 저장소 및 관련 서비스를 운영하기 위한 서버 컴퓨터 구매 비용 |
| 서버 관리 | 서버 운영, 유지 보수, 보안 관리 등에 필요한 인력 또는 외주 비용 |
| 네트워크 비용 | 서버와 사용자 간의 데이터 전송을 위한 네트워크 연결 비용 |
| 교육 및 컨설팅 | 서브시전 사용법, 설정, 문제 해결 등에 대한 교육 및 컨설팅 비용 (필요한 경우) |
서브시전, 어디에 어떻게 활용될까?
서브시전은 소프트웨어 개발 분야뿐만 아니라, 다양한 분야에서 활용될 수 있습니다. 코드 버전 관리 외에도, 문서 관리, 디자인 파일 관리, 그리고 프로젝트 히스토리 관리에 이르기까지, 변경 사항을 추적하고 관리해야 하는 모든 분야에서 유용하게 사용됩니다.
소프트웨어 개발: 협업과 효율의 핵심
가장 일반적인 사용 사례는 소프트웨어 개발입니다. 여러 개발자가 하나의 프로젝트에 참여하여 코드를 작성하고, 수정하고, 통합하는 과정에서 서브시전은 필수적인 도구입니다. 코드의 버전 관리, 변경 사항 추적, 그리고 충돌 해결을 통해 개발 효율을 극대화하고, 안정적인 소프트웨어 개발을 가능하게 합니다. 또한, 오픈소스 프로젝트에서도 서브시전은 중요한 역할을 담당합니다.
비 소프트웨어 분야: 문서 관리, 디자인 파일 관리
소프트웨어 개발 외에도, 서브시전은 문서 관리, 디자인 파일 관리 등 다양한 분야에서 활용됩니다. 예를 들어, 여러 사람이 함께 작성하는 보고서나 매뉴얼의 경우, 서브시전을 이용하여 변경 사항을 추적하고, 이전 버전으로 복원할 수 있습니다. 디자인 파일 관리에서도, 디자인 수정 내역을 기록하고, 필요에 따라 이전 디자인으로 되돌아갈 수 있습니다.
| 활용 분야 | 활용 방법 |
|---|---|
| 소프트웨어 개발 | 코드 버전 관리, 변경 사항 추적, 협업, 오픈소스 프로젝트 관리 |
| 문서 관리 | 여러 사람이 함께 작성하는 문서의 버전 관리, 변경 사항 추적, 이전 버전 복원 |
| 디자인 파일 관리 | 디자인 수정 내역 기록, 이전 디자인 복원, 협업 |
| 프로젝트 히스토리 관리 | 프로젝트 진행 상황, 변경 사항, 문제 해결 과정을 기록하고 관리하여, 향후 유사한 프로젝트 진행 시 참고 자료로 활용 |
서브시전의 가치, 가격 그 이상
서브시전의 가치는 단순히 0원이라는 가격으로 평가할 수 없습니다. 서브시전은 기술적 성장을 위한 강력한 도구이며, 협업과 소통을 촉진하는 플랫폼입니다. 또한, 오픈소스 커뮤니티에 기여하고, 지식을 공유하는 기회를 제공합니다.
기술적 성장: 숙련된 개발자로의 발돋움
서브시전을 사용하면서, 개발자는 코드 관리, 버전 관리, 협업 기술 등 다양한 기술을 습득하게 됩니다. 이는 개발자의 역량을 향상시키고, 더 나아가 숙련된 개발자로 성장하는 데 기여합니다. 또한, 서브시전을 통해 문제 해결 능력, 분석 능력, 그리고 의사소통 능력까지 향상시킬 수 있습니다.
커뮤니티 기여: 함께 성장하는 경험
서브시전은 오픈소스 프로젝트이므로, 누구나 자유롭게 참여하고 기여할 수 있습니다. 개발자들은 코드 수정, 버그 수정, 문서 작성 등 다양한 방식으로 커뮤니티에 기여할 수 있습니다. 이는 개인의 성장뿐만 아니라, 오픈소스 생태계를 발전시키는 데에도 기여합니다. 함께 배우고, 함께 성장하는 경험은 서브시전이 제공하는 가장 큰 가치 중 하나입니다.
| 가치 | 설명 |
|---|---|
| 기술적 성장 | 코드 관리, 버전 관리, 협업 기술 등 다양한 기술 습득 |
| 협업과 소통 | 효율적인 협업 환경 구축, 문제 해결 능력 향상, 의사소통 능력 향상 |
| 커뮤니티 기여 | 오픈소스 프로젝트 참여, 코드 수정, 버그 수정, 문서 작성 등 기회 제공, 함께 성장하는 경험 제공 |
서브시전 사용, 시작하는 방법
서브시전을 처음 접하는 분들을 위해, 서브시전을 시작하는 간단한 방법을 안내해 드리겠습니다.
설치 및 설정 가이드
서브시전은 다양한 운영체제에서 사용할 수 있습니다. 먼저, 운영체제에 맞는 서브시전 클라이언트를 다운로드하여 설치해야 합니다. 설치 후에는, 저장소를 생성하고, 코드를 저장소에 추가하여 버전 관리를 시작할 수 있습니다. 서브시전 사용에 대한 자세한 내용은 공식 문서나 온라인 튜토리얼을 참고하시기 바랍니다.